The Processing Guidelines document provides a comprehensive troubleshooting guide for common issues encountered in injection molding, such as black specks, blisters, brittleness, burns, and bubbles. Each section offers actionable advice on adjusting processing parameters like temperature, injection speed, back pressure, and mold temperature to improve part quality. Additionally, it includes best practices for drying, mold maintenance, and venting to minimize defects and enhance consistency. This guide is an essential resource for operators and technicians aiming to optimize molding processes, ensuring efficient production and high-quality outputs.
